Frequently Asked Questions About Weekends

What is Weekends about and what kind of topics does it cover?

This podcast presents a unique blend of storytelling and expert commentary on a wide range of topics that reflect the diverse landscape of contemporary Canadian society. Key themes include political analysis, public health issues, and discussions about social justice, all framed through a distinctly Canadian lens. Additionally, the conversations often include insights on emerging trends such as artificial intelligence and environmental concerns, making it relevant not just for Canadian listeners, but for anyone interested in the complexities of these global issues. The host brings a wealth of broadcast journalism experience, infusing each episode with informed perspectives and engaging dialogue.
